Fly Extermination Questions
What are fly extermination services? Fly extermination involves removing and controlling fly populations to prevent infestations and reduce nuisances on residential or commercial properties.
When should property owners consider fly extermination? Extermination is recommended when flies are seen in large numbers, around food or waste, or persistently entering indoor spaces.
What types of fly problems are commonly addressed? Services typically target house flies, fruit flies, cluster flies, and other common species causing indoor or outdoor issues.
How can property owners prevent future fly problems? Eliminating breeding sites, maintaining cleanliness, and sealing entry points can help reduce the likelihood of fly infestations.
